A fantastic career opportunity working in Property Management with a well-established property company in Edinburgh! If you enjoy a fast-paced role, have an interest in property/buildings and great people skills this is an excellent opening that’s open to candidates looking to career change!
Due to continued growth, this forward-thinking business is now recruiting for a Client Relationship Manager to act as the main point of contact for property owner clients, looking after your own portfolio of property developments across Edinburgh/East Scotland, building strong customer relationships.
Your key duties will include:
- Acting as the main point of contact for clients in relation to property repairs, building services, billing queries and ongoing property projects
- Proactively building strong client relationships and delivering great customer service
- Taking full ownership of all day-to-day issues within your portfolio - liaising with internal and external contacts and keeping clients fully updated
- Visiting property developments
- Leading and conducting meetings with groups of clients
- Complaints management and resolution
- Understanding technical aspects of property management and communicating these effectively to clients
- Being an active team player - working closely with colleagues to meet deadlines and deliver consistently high levels of service to clients
- All connected administration including financial/budget setting for property developments
We are open to candidates from various backgrounds, including those in other areas of property; however, it’s important you have proven experience in a service/client relationship-based role. You should be a great communicator who builds relationships easily, enjoys problem-solving and has the ability to organise and manage a busy workload. A confident level of Admin/IT skills is preferred, and a driving licence is essential.
Full training provided – working hours 9am-5pm Monday to Friday with hybrid working (3 days at home, 2 in office). Starting salary circa £30k with benefits package, and superb career prospects.
